5 fish traders, staff injured in attack

Staff Correspondent
Five people were injured as a gang of miscreants attacked the traders and employees of a fish market at Merul Badda in the city yesterday. Three of the injured were rushed to Dhaka Medical College Hospital while two others were given first aid at a local clinic in the area. Meer Fakrul Alam, president of Merul Badda Fish Market Owners Welfare Association, told the correspondent that a gang of 15 to 20 criminals attacked the traders and workers of the market, leaving five traders and employees injured. He said the fish traders blocked the road near the market for half an hour protesting the attack and demanding arrest of the culprits. They withdrew the blockade following assurance from police. Fakrul alleged that a local group led by one Shahin had killed his brother in January, 2009. The group was pressing to withdraw the murder case when they sat to settle a matter over a recent altercation between a trader and a member of the group.
